Remote access security acts as something of a virtual barrier, preventing unauthorized access to data and assets beyond the traditional network perimeter. The technologies for secure remote access can range from VPNs and multi-factor authentication to more advanced access and zero trust controls.
Log monitoring is the process of analyzing log file data produced by applications, systems and devices to look for anomalous events that could signal cybersecurity, performance or other problems. How Log Monitoring Works Log monitoring is the process of ingesting log files and parsing them for security and operational issues.

Endpoint security should constantly monitor all endpoint activity, so it will see ransomware as it unfolds—it can then rapidly terminate the offending processes, preventing endpoint encryption, and stopping the ransomware attack in its tracks. The exploit prevention feature will defend endpoints from exploit-based, memory injection attacks.

Network Security Network security is the first layer of protection in cloud databases that employs firewalls to prevent unwanted access. Firewalls help you comply with cloud data security policies by regulating incoming and outgoing traffic using software, hardware, or cloud technologies.
